NEW YORK, Aug. 6 /PRNewswire/ -- Phelps Dodge Corporation announced today that it will suspend copper production from its New Cornelia branch mine and concentrator at Ajo, Ariz. effective Sunday, Aug. 12. The smelter at Ajo will continue to operate, treating material from Phelps Dodge's other mines at Morenci, Ariz. and Tyrone, N.M.
The company said that it was hopeful that the price of copper would improve sufficiently in the coming months to permit an early resumption of operations.
